Output 5babd592c1669b8abaf1935b4738736db42ea8f6f0b1fb7efe4eb8ea95636784:0

value
12874370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562e9f0f301a0f04e0a604eeda6ba30107fa300d OP_EQUAL
address
39YhtM7mCxSz8cwrLVeNZotrgnQiw1GcDr
transaction
5babd592c1669b8abaf1935b4738736db42ea8f6f0b1fb7efe4eb8ea95636784
spent
true